melodies

英 [ˈmɛlədiz]

美 [ˈmɛlədiz]

n.  旋律; 曲调; (尤指)主旋律; (旋律简洁的)乐曲,歌曲; 乐曲的音符编排
melody的复数

柯林斯词典

  • 旋律;曲调
    Amelodyis a tune.
    1. N-UNCOUNT 婉转;悦耳
      Melodyis the quality of having a pleasant tune.
      1. Her voice was full of melody.
        她的声音非常悦耳。
